As meeems mentioned... the Exotic blend is a great juice... IMO it does need a steep ( like all of the tobacco's I've tried ) so everything blends properly so one flavor note doesn't overwhelm any other. Tabac de Perique is currently my favorite one and has currently pushed the Exotic blend from that position. I also really love French Pipe... it does have some cherry and vanilla notes in it but it is really nice for an evening vape. French Pipe is offered in a standard and full bodied versions, I'm about to need to order some more and I seriously can't decide which way I want it on the next order... I'm barely leaning towards the full bodied, but just barely.

I believe you were also the one asking about steeping. Convention steeping is just taking the top off of a bottle, placing it into a cool dark location and letting it sit until it has fully melded all of the flavors together.
You can also do almost the same thing by doing a "quick steep". Take a square of plastic wrap ( saran wrap etc ), place the bottle in the center of the wrap, wrap it up and seal it good with a bread tie... Then take a cup or bowl of hot water ( hot tap or microwaved ), shake the bottle up well, place it into the hot water and let it sit until the water has cooled... repeat it about 3-4 times... Remember to shake each time you place it back into the hot water. Of the juices I've done this on, they were fine ( for me ) right after I finished it.
A small warning... I've used several brands/types of baggies... all of them let water in and ran the label until they were almost unreadable. You can always use a magic marker to relabel them if it happens ... but if you steeped several bottles at once and they all end up being almost unreadable... it make it fun to figure out which is which if they each look/smell similarly.
